Earl Scruggs died March 28 at 88 years old.

I grew up listening to my dad's record (as in a real LP33) of Flatt & Scruggs Live at Carnegie Hall from about 1963. It's a classic and now I have it on CD.

Earl revolutionized banjo playing and inspired generations of banjo musicians. He will be missed.
